Hint: After you deep clean the tops of your kitchen cabinets, put a layer of wax paper over the tops or the cabinets. Then, the next time you need to clean up there, just fold up the old wax paper and put down a new layer. I learned this from a professional housecleaning expert.

Hello. Inspiring video to clean and de clutter along with you. I fill my kitchen sink with hot water, white vinegar and baking soda and put my pots, cookie pans and every article that is dirty. Leave them for some time and then scrub. All the black under the pots clean very well. I live in Costa Rica.
